Commercial Masonry Repair in Elkmont, AL
Commercial masonry repair services involve restoring and maintaining the structural integrity of masonry elements on commercial properties, including brickwork, stonework, concrete blocks, and other masonry materials. These services typically cover projects such as fixing cracks, replacing damaged bricks or stones, repairing mortar joints, and addressing issues caused by weathering, settling, or aging. Property owners usually want to understand the scope of repairs needed, the materials used, and the potential impact on the property's appearance and stability before requesting service.
Before initiating a commercial masonry repair, property owners often seek information about the extent of damage, the recommended repair methods, and the longevity of the solutions provided. It’s important to consider the specific types of masonry involved, the overall condition of the structure, and any underlying issues that may need to be addressed to prevent future problems. Clear communication about project details helps ensure that repairs are effective, durable, and aligned with the property's maintenance needs.

Common Commercial Masonry Repair Jobs
Brick and Masonry Repair - restoring damaged or cracked brickwork to maintain structural integrity.
Stonework Restoration - repairing and preserving natural stone features on commercial properties.
Concrete Repair - fixing cracks, spalling, or uneven surfaces in concrete structures.
Masonry Repointing - renewing mortar joints to prevent water infiltration and improve appearance.
Facade Restoration - repairing and restoring exterior masonry to enhance curb appeal.
Structural Masonry Repair - addressing foundation or load-bearing wall issues for safety and stability.
Commercial Masonry Repair Questions
What types of masonry repair services are offered for commercial properties? Services include repairing brickwork, stonework, concrete, and mortar joints to restore structural integrity and appearance.
What signs indicate that a commercial masonry structure needs repair? Cracks, spalling, efflorescence, and water infiltration are common signs that masonry repair may be necessary.
Are structural repairs necessary for all visible cracks in masonry? Not all cracks require repair; a professional assessment can determine if they impact safety or stability.
What materials are typically used in commercial masonry repair? Repair materials often include matching mortar, sealants, and replacement bricks or stones to ensure durability and visual consistency.
